The Cardinals are welcoming 12 newcomers for year one under new head coach Pat Kelsey.
LOUISVILLE, Ky. - Since being named the head coach of the Louisville men's basketball program back on Mar. 28, Pat Kelsey has done a masterful job on the roster management front.
As of this writing, Louisville has filled all but one of their 13 open scholarships, bringing in 11 transfers and one high school prospect to form a roster that very well seems like it will be competitive in year one of the Kelsey era. While the 2024-25 season is still months away, national outlets are beginning to agree with that sentiment.with the majority of the transfer portal action across college basketball said and done.
